Output 58fc8363fed6c35a1e02e6022a984dd4b24983880856d4ef57d14ff3cd84027b:0

value
25246572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05f3261e50a736ea1705608c67bd1cedf8821d07 OP_EQUALVERIFY OP_CHECKSIG
address
LKmQvTHEfsRp6JzZS2sNJLZeWWKArLgg4F
transaction
58fc8363fed6c35a1e02e6022a984dd4b24983880856d4ef57d14ff3cd84027b
spent
true